Deficiencies in which element can produce depression of both Band T-cell function?
Iron
Zinc
Iodine
Magnesium - ANSWER-ANS: B
Of the options available, only deficient zinc intake can
profoundly depress T- and B-cell function.

An Rh-negative woman gave birth to an Rh-positive baby. When
discussing Rho[D] immunoglobulin with her, what information
should the healthcare professional provide?
It provides protection against infection from poor immunity in the
baby.
It prevents alloimmunity and hemolytic anemia of the newborn.
It provides necessary antibodies in case the mother doesn't
breastfeed.
It causes the intestinal tract of the newborn to produce antibodies. -
ANSWER-ANS: B
Alloimmunity occurs when an individual's immune system
reacts against antigens on the tissues of other members of the
same species. This can occur when a woman is Rh- negative
and gives birth to an Rh-positive baby, leading to hemolytic
anemia of the newborn. Rho[D] immunoglobulin does not
provide protection against infection, provide antibodies to a
bottle-fed baby, or cause the intestine to produce antibodies.

Tissue damage caused by the deposition of circulating immune
complexes containing an antibody against the host DNA is the
cause of which disease?
Hemolytic anemia
Pernicious anemia
Systemic lupus erythematosus
Myasthenia gravis - ANSWER-ANS: C
The deposition of circulating immune complexes containing
an antibody against the host DNA produces tissue damage in
individuals with systemic lupus erythematosus (SLE). That is
not a process in hemolytic anemia, pernicious anemia, or
myasthenia gravis.
